Security

Smart keys are more practical than traditional keys and come with additional security and safety features. They communicate with the computer system of your car using radio-frequency identification (RFID). An antenna in your car detects the signal from the key when it is within the range of the key, allowing you to unlock your doors and start your engine without having to take out your phone or press the button.

This may seem like a convenient feature. However, car smart key replacement thieves can access this system to open your doors, or even start the engine. Certain manufacturers employ "rolling code" technology to prevent this. This code is projected from the key to the starter and then verified by the car's computer before the car starts. This stops thieves from creating multiple copies of keys.

Battery Life

Typically, smart keys last half as long as regular fobs with key blades (two to three years versus four to six). This is because the smart keys have to communicate with the car more often and at a higher frequency to unlock and begin the. Smart keys can also be drained faster if they are placed near electronic devices like computers, phones and screens that emit electromagnetic fields.

Fortunately, most smart key locksmith near me keys come with batteries backup features. According to Open Road Auto Group, most have an emergency blade that acts as traditional keys to open the door for the driver in the event that the smart key battery dies. Most also have a special slot that lets you insert a traditional key in order to turn on the engine in the event that the smart key is not functioning.
